[QUOTE="Wippit Guud, post: 1051935, member: 720"] [b]Oh poor twisted me...[/b] [U][B]Fellslime[/B][/U] [B]Advanced Fiendish Half-Dragon(Black) Black Pudding[/B] Gargantuan Dragon/Ooze (extraplanar) [B]Hit Dice:[/B] 30d12+210 (405 hp) [B]Initiative:[/B] -1 (-5 Dex, +4 Improved initiative) [B]Speed:[/B] 20 ft. (4 squares), climb 20 ft, fly 40 ft (average) [B]Armor Class:[/B] 12 (-2 size, -4 Dex, +8 natural), touch 3, flat-footed 11 [B]Base Attack/Grapple: +22/+46 [B]Attack: [/B]Slam +33 melee (2d6+11 19-20 plus 3d6 acid) [B]Full Attack: [/B]3 slams +33/+33/+28 melee (2d6+11/2d6+11/3d6+5 19-20 plus 3d6 acid on each hit) [B]Space/Reach: [/B]20 ft./15 ft. [B]Special Attacks: [/B]Acid, constrict 3d6+11 plus 3d6 acid, improved grab, smite good, breath weapon [B]Special Qualities: [/B]Blindsight 60 ft., split, ooze traits, dark/low-light vision 60 ft, immune to sleep, paralysis, and acid, damage reduction 10/magic, cold/fire resist 10, SR 25, [B]Saves:[/B] Fort +9, Ref -1, Will -2 [B]Abilities:[/B] Str 33, Dex 1, Con 28, Int 2, Wis 1, Cha 3 [B]Skills:[/B] Climb +34 [B]Feats:[/B] Awesome blow, cleave, flyby attack, great cleave, hover, improved bull rush, improved critical(slam), improved initiative, power attack, wingover [B]Challenge Rating: [/B]12 [B]Treasure:[/B] None [B]Alignment:[/B] Always Neutral Evil The mere existance of such a creature has been a great debate among scholars who specilize in outer planes creatures. Most think it just a myth, while a select few believe them to be a product of the twisted mind of Juiblex, God of Slime. They would be surprised to know that these lifeforms are more numerous that you might expect, due to the fact that they can simply split in half to reproduce. Fellslime at first looks like a typical, albeit much larger, black pudding. But looks in the case are definitely deceiving. Because of the dragonish blood running through it, fellslime has intelligence - no more than an animal, but it can think for itself. This allows it to come up with tactics when trying to overcome a foe. It can also manipulate it's body to grow wings, allowing it to fly, something no one would expect of an ooze creature. Combat Fellslime has three attack, 2 quick jabs slams and a follow-up larger slam. All 3 attacks cause additional acid damage as well as allow a grapplt attack check. Acid (Ex): The creature secretes a digestive acid that dissolves organic material and metal quickly, but does not affect stone. Any melee hit or constrict attack deals acid damage, and the opponent's armor and clothing dissolve and become useless immediately unless they succeed on DC 24 Reflex saves. A metal or wooden weapon that strikes a black pudding also dissolves immediately unless it succeeds on a DC 24 Reflex save. The save DCs are Constitution-based. The pudding's acidic touch deals 21 points of damage per round to wooden or metal objects, but the ooze must remain in contact with the object for 1 full round to deal this damage. Constrict (Ex): A black pudding deals automatic slam and acid damage with a successful grapple check. The opponent's clothing and armor take a -4 penalty on Reflex saves against the acid. Improved Grab (Ex): To use this ability, a black pudding must hit with its slam attack. It can then attempt to start a grapple as a free action without provoking an attack of opportunity. If it wins the grapple check, it establishes a hold and can constrict. Smite Good (Su): Once per day the creature can make a normal melee attack to deal extra damage equal to its HD total (maximum of +20) against a good foe. Breath Weapon: can breathe a 60 ft line of acid once per day, dealing 6d8 points of acid damage. A successful Reflex save (DC 34) reduces this damage by half. Special qualities Split (Ex): Slashing and piercing weapons deal no damage to a fellslime. Instead the creature splits into two identical puddings, each with half of the original's current hit points (round down). A fellslime with 10 hit points or less cannot be further split and dies if reduced to 0 hit points. Skills: Fellslime has a +8 racial bonus on Climb checks and can always choose to take 10 on a Climb check, even if rushed or threatened[/B] [/QUOTE]
